Santa Cruz Megatower C 90 Full Suspension Mountain Bike
The Megatower C 90 is a long travel 29er built for speed, stability and control on steep, rough terrain. Its Carbon C frame, 170 mm travel and VPP suspension platform give confident handling on big mountain trails while the steep seat angle keeps climbing efficient. It is a strong choice for enduro racing, park laps and technical all mountain riding.
Key Features
- Carbon C frame with 170 mm VPP suspension
- FOX 38 Float Performance fork and Float X Performance shock
- SRAM 90 Eagle T Type drivetrain with 10 52t range
- SRAM Maven Base brakes with 200 mm HS2 rotors
- Reserve alloy wheelset with Maxxis Assegai and Minion DHR II tyres
FOX 38 and Float X suspension
A FOX 38 Float Performance fork with 170 mm travel pairs with a FOX Float X Performance shock. This setup gives support, grip and control on long technical descents.
SRAM 90 Eagle T Type drivetrain
The SRAM 90 Eagle T Type drivetrain provides smooth shifting under load with a wide 10 52t range. A OneUp bash guide adds chain security for aggressive riding.
SRAM Maven Base brakes
SRAM Maven Base brakes with 200 mm HS2 rotors deliver strong, predictable stopping power for steep terrain and high speed riding.
Reserve alloy wheels and Maxxis tyres
Reserve 30 TR AL and Reserve 30 HD AL rims are matched with DT Swiss 370 hubs for durability. Maxxis Assegai and Minion DHR II tyres in MaxxGrip and Double Down casings give grip and support on demanding trails.
